Charming 2-level, 3-bedroom home with an additional den (or 4th bedroom) in sought-after Canyon Heights, just across from Cleveland Dam. This bright, contemporary home offers a perfect blend of character and modern updates, including a beautifully renovated ensuite bathroom, gleaming hardwood flooring, and a sunroom leading to a private, fenced backyard. The main level features an extra-large den ideal for a home office, with vaulted ceilings and an atrium that fills the space with natural light. French doors open to the garden, offering a serene outdoor retreat. The roof was replaced in 2018 and comes with a 50-year warranty for added peace of mind.
